Exhaust ducts shall terminate not fewer than 3 ft in any course from openings into buildings. Exhaust duct terminations shall be Outfitted with a backdraft damper. Screens shall not be mounted with the duct termination

Marketed by some producers as being a "static clothes drying approach", convectant dryers simply include a heating unit at The underside, a vertical chamber, and a vent at top rated. The device heats air at the bottom, reducing its relative humidity, as well as the all-natural inclination of sizzling air to increase delivers this low-humidity air into contact with the clothes.
